Hemedti’s Adviser Defects, Surrenders to Government

Sources told Shahed Ayan platform that Ibrahim Younis, an adviser to the Rapid Support Forces (RSF) militia, has defected and officially surrendered to the Sudanese government.

Reports indicated that the defection was driven by widespread discontent among fighters from the Messeiriya tribe, who accused the militia leadership of colluding with South Sudan over the disputed Abyei issue.

According to the same sources, Younis’s move could pave the way for a broader wave of defections, as other tribal members within the militia are now considering withdrawing from the fighting in the coming period due to escalating internal disputes over issues of significance to the tribe.
